A relay is needed as you can't run 12V into that 209 wire as you will inflict some damage.  All the system is looking for is that wire to be grounded for the recording to be turned on.  As far as a relay goes, a simple 4 or or 5 post model will be fine and shouldn't cost you any more than $10 at your local auto parts store or equipment dealer.  Here is a picture of how you will want to hook it up:
